If you know where you're going its something like 30 minutes going the legal speed limit.

Its only about 22 km from the Hotel de Ville (city hall) in Paris to the Hotel de Ville in Versailles.

Can depend a lot on the time of day, which day of the week and even, if it's a holiday period. Roads around Paris can get heavily congested and can make a short trip take about 3 times longer than it should.

I would advise using the RER suburban train to get to Versailles because it will be a lot less hassle than driving - unless you really have to take a car.
